Output 3ecbe0e98332c223d07291ed4e7e2facf3c32da3d947a7e29f2aede8b5bcdcd2:1

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a68c42d4ea18f7e2cee3e12701d71b8fd55199 OP_EQUAL
address
3M5QhANa7WYH3DxgYP9vh1WXGdkVDAzbhw
transaction
3ecbe0e98332c223d07291ed4e7e2facf3c32da3d947a7e29f2aede8b5bcdcd2
confirmations
178642
spent
true